SIM Service, Use and Responsibility

– SIMs provisioned for dual‑network LTE access (Telstra & Optus); actual coverage subject to network availability and local conditions

– SIM activation/service periods commence on Activation/Registration Date and measured per calendar month

– Customer liable for all activity and charges on registered SIMs (data, messages, calls, roaming, third‑party charges)

– Data allowance: 600 MB per SIM per calendar month; N56A expected to typically use <300 MB per calendar month

– Usage cap: Customer must not use >600 MB per SIM per calendar month unless Provider agrees in writing

– Over‑use: SIMs recording >600 MB in a calendar month deemed associated with unauthorised device/use case; Provider may monitor usage, notify Customer, suspend service, apply over‑use charges or void service

– Notice & cure: where practicable Provider will give written notice and 48‑hour cure period prior to permanent suspension/voiding, except where immediate action needed for security, fraud, unlawful use or network operator requirements

– Measurement: Provider’s monitoring systems measure usage; Provider records are prima facie evidence

– Prohibited uses: unlawful activity, fraud, bulk‑messaging, unauthorised tethering, or other prohibited purposes; Provider may monitor and act to protect networks and compliance

Renewal, Replacement and Migration Fees

– SIM renewals, replacements, reactivations or provisioning changes subject to Provider’s current fees (e.g., 12‑month renewal fee currently $97.50)

– Migration from RapidPTT LiTE to Enterprise may incur setup/migration fees and Enterprise monthly charges; lead times provided by Provider

– Access to Talkpod Australia RapidPTT Servers and Enterprise Options

– RapidPTT LiTE server access provided free for life of radio for devices on RapidPTT LiTE channel

– Enterprise available for multi‑channel and Enterprise features (including Rapid Command)

– Rapid Command charge: $22.00 per device per calendar month (ex GST) or Provider’s then‑current rate; other Enterprise features may incur fees

– Radios on Enterprise may access RapidPTT LiTE; RapidPTT LiTE devices cannot access Enterprise‑only channels/features unless migrated to Enterprise (migration = re‑provisioning + Enterprise fees per device)

– Provider will publish current pricing, setup and migration instructions; prices may change with notice

 

Warranty and Disclaimers

– Device warranty: N56A warranted against defects in materials/workmanship for 24 months from delivery, subject to proper use/maintenance and these Terms

– Accessories: manufacturer’s warranty for 12 months from delivery; accessory claims subject to manufacturer’s terms

– Exclusions: loss, theft, cosmetic damage, consumables, misuse, unauthorised repair/modification, improper installation, water ingress (where not rated), third‑party network/product issues not covered

– Remedies: Provider may repair, replace (may be refurbished) or refund item price for valid warranty claims

– Disclaimer: to extent permitted by law, all other warranties, representations or conditions excluded; nothing excludes non‑excludable rights under Australian Consumer Law

Talkpod Australia are the exclusive Australian national distributor of the N5 Smart Series. Talkpod Australia is division of First Class Electronic Services Pty Ltd servicing the Australian radiocommunications industry since 1985.
